Position Overview:
The Commercial Operations Regional Team is the face of global Commercial Strategy and Services Operations at Expedia. As regional commercial guides, we are charged with accountability and communication on issues and projects for our assigned regions EMEA, APAC & Americas. For this position, we are looking for a strong operational partner; focused, organized and detail oriented, with excellence in communication and air product knowledge for North America.

Responsibilities in this Position:
• Prioritize, triage and track issues in regards to air and car shopping, pricing, booking and ticketing impacting relevant regions. Own and drive issues into the appropriate Global Functional Support teams that resolve them.
• Collaborate closely with Expedia's Air & Car Commercial team, Product Management, Technology, other cross functional teams on critical issues, inquiry requests & new initiatives.
• Become an authority on the Expedia Brands in the North American region.
• Support the strategic objectives of the air & car business for their region
• Support the rollout of new features, product offerings and drive new Points of Sale work from an operational delivery perspective.
• Provide continuous feedback to internal customers through meetings & formal reporting.
• Research & analyze trends in transactional data if needed, to continually improve the customer experience and operating costs.
• Support specific in-country initiatives, products, workflows and air fulfillment performance.
Requirements and Qualifications:
• You have 4 - 7 years of relevant, professional work experience with strong knowledge of the tour, car, air and travel marketplace and a sound understanding of regulatory requirements.
•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
• You present with strong skills to analyze complex issues and possess problem-solving skills.
• Collaborate and work closely with business partners to define, implement and support travel products.
• Strong customer orientation and the ability to work across multiple business divisions.
• Highly flexible and capable of navigating through complex issues in a dynamic environment.
• Advanced analytical skills to support the optimization of varied business opportunities and ability to effectively prioritize tasks.
• You constantly wonder about a better solution or different path to get to the goal.
• Proven knowledge of Global Distribution Systems, Travel Agency Automation and Fares & Pricing.
• Excellent communication & interpersonal skills.
• Ability to gain a quick understanding on technology with a particular focus on e-commerce.
